Originally posted by Starrman
hand mute? Clearly a retard wrote it, whatever it is. Try finding another tab by someone else and comparing. Alternatively, listen to the actual tune and work it out yourself, then email them and tell them they're idiots..
I agree with the last sentence, try lifting it yourself. If you're stuck, try finding the right bass note, then the right chord quality (major, minor, dominant, other) then find the right voicing. You'll be surprised how much better it sounds when you find out what's on the actual record rather than using a basic chord chart.
